> When you do have time look these up though.
> Philip Rahv, "Proletarian Literature: A Political Autopsy", Southern
> Review, 1939. Contained in, "Essays on Literature and Politics,
> 1932-1972, "ed. Arabel T. Porter and Andrew J. Dvosin (Boston:
> Houghton Mifflin, 1978), 293-304.
> The classic, "Writers on the Left, " by Daniel Aaron, reissued by
> Columbia Univ. Press.
> Barbara Foley, 'Radical Representations: Politics and Form in U.S.
> Proletarian Fictions, 1929-1941." (Durham and London: Duke University
> Press, 1993)
> "The Radical Novel, " by Walter Rideout, reissued by Columbia Univ.
> Press.
>
> Paula Rabinowitz Labor and Desire, Women's Revolutionary Fiction in
> Depression America (Chapel Hill: The University of North Carolina
> Press, 1991)
> Constance Coiner's Better Red: The Writing and Resistance of Tillie
> Olsen and Meridel Le Sueur (New York and Oxford: Oxford University
> Press, 1995)
